The integumentary system, or simply, the integument, protects the inside of the body. The integument includes skin, hair, feathers, fur, toenails, fingernails, and so forth.

What are the major organs of the integementary system?

The major organs of the integumentary system are the skin, hair, nails, and exocrine glands. These organs work together to provide protection, regulate body temperature, and support sensory functions.
